Cette page explique comment assurer la disponibilité de la base de données et éviter les temps d'arrêt des instances en augmentant le quota de stockage du cluster dans AlloyDB. Elle explique également le fonctionnement de l'outil de recommandation pour le quota de stockage du cluster et comment l'utiliser.
L'outil de recommandation de quota d'espace de stockage pour les clusters AlloyDB vous aide à détecter les clusters de production qui risquent d'atteindre le quota d'espace de stockage.
L'outil de recommandation de quota de stockage de cluster AlloyDB analyse certaines métriques liées au stockage et calcule la dernière utilisation du quota de stockage par le cluster. Si l'utilisation dépasse un certain seuil, le cluster reçoit une recommandation pour augmenter le quota de stockage. Les recommandations sont générées quotidiennement.
Avant de commencer
Afin de pouvoir afficher les recommandations et les insights, procédez comme suit :
Assurez-vous d'activer l'API Recommender.
Pour obtenir les autorisations permettant d'afficher et d'utiliser les insights et les recommandations, assurez-vous de disposer des rôles IAM (Identity and Access Management) requis.
Tasks Rôles Afficher les recommandations recommender.alloydbViewer
oualloydb.viewer
.Appliquer les recommandations recommender.alloydbAdmin
oualloydb.admin
.Pour en savoir plus, consultez Accorder l'accès à d'autres utilisateurs.
Répertorier les recommandations
Vous pouvez répertorier les recommandations de quota de stockage du cluster à l'aide de la console Google Cloud , de gcloud CLI
ou de l'API Recommender.
Console
Dans la console Google Cloud , accédez à la page Clusters.
Pour en savoir plus, consultez Trouver des recommandations avec le hub de recommandations.
Dans la fiche Configuration de la disponibilité, cliquez sur Quota de stockage bientôt atteint.
Une liste des clusters auxquels s'applique la recommandation Quota de stockage bientôt atteint s'affiche.
CLI gcloud
Pour lister les recommandations de quota de stockage du cluster à l'aide de gcloud CLI, exécutez la commande gcloud recommender recommendations list
comme suit :
gcloud recommender recommendations list \ --project=PROJECT_ID \ --location=LOCATION \ --recommender=google.alloydb.cluster.ReliabilityRecommender \ --filter=recommenderSubtype=INCREASE_CLUSTER_STORAGE_QUOTA
Remplacez les éléments suivants :
PROJECT_ID
: ID de votre projetLOCATION
: région où se trouvent vos clusters, par exempleus-central1
.
API
Pour lister les recommandations de quota de stockage de cluster à l'aide de l'API Recommendations, appelez la méthode recommendations.list
comme suit :
GET https://recommender.googleapis.com/v1/projects/PROJECT_ID/locations/LOCATION/recommenders/google.alloydb.cluster.ReliabilityRecommender/recommendations?filter=recommenderSubtype=INCREASE_CLUSTER_STORAGE_QUOTA
Remplacez les éléments suivants :
PROJECT_ID
: ID de votre projetLOCATION
: région où se trouvent vos clusters, par exempleus-central1
.
Afficher les insights et les recommandations détaillées
Vous pouvez afficher les insights et les recommandations détaillées concernant les clusters nécessitant une augmentation du quota de stockage à l'aide de la console Google Cloud , de gcloud CLI
ou de l'API Recommender.
Pour afficher les insights et les recommandations détaillées, procédez comme suit :
Console
Sur la page Clusters, cliquez sur la recommandation Quota de stockage bientôt atteint pour une instance dans la colonne Problèmes. Le panneau de recommandations s'affiche. Il contient des insights et des recommandations détaillées.
CLI gcloud
Exécutez la commande gcloud recommender insights list
comme suit :
gcloud recommender insights list \ --project=PROJECT_ID \ --location=LOCATION \ --insight-type=google.alloydb.cluster.ReliabilityInsight \ --filter=insightSubtype=HIGH_STORAGE_UTILIZATION
Remplacez les éléments suivants :
- PROJECT_ID : ID de votre projet
- LOCATION : région où se trouvent vos clusters, par exemple
us-central1
.
API
Appelez la méthode insights.list
comme suit :
GET https://recommender.googleapis.com/v1/projects/PROJECT_ID/locations/LOCATION/insightTypes/google.alloydb.cluster.ReliabilityInsight/insights?filter=insightSubtype=HIGH_STORAGE_UTILIZATION
Remplacez les éléments suivants :
- PROJECT_ID : ID de votre projet
- LOCATION : région où se trouvent vos clusters, par exemple
us-central1
.
Appliquer la recommandation
Étudiez attentivement la recommandation et procédez comme suit :
Console
Pour mettre en œuvre la recommandation, procédez comme suit :
- Cliquez sur Modifier le quota pour votre cluster. La fenêtre IAM et administration > Quotas et limites du système s'affiche automatiquement.
- Sélectionnez l'entrée de votre cluster, puis cliquez sur Modifier les quotas.
- Dans la fenêtre Modifier le quota, saisissez la valeur de quota appropriée, conformément à la recommandation.
- Renseignez les informations requises dans le champ Description de la demande, puis cliquez sur OK.
- Cliquez sur Envoyer la requête.